January 25, 2008, Newsletter Issue #100: The Cost To Construct

Tip of the Week

An in ground swimming pool is a bit more of an investment than a mister turtle plastic pool. Before you dig deep in the ground, however, you might have to dig deep within your pockets. Your best bet is to factor in all the cost factors before building.

There are not only material costs, but construction as well. The total price (depending on materials) could run you somewhere between $18 and $30 grand (this does not include the extras like a filter system, chemicals even a pool cover). Even after you're done adding up those costs, you still have yearly costs for up-keep and opening the swimming pool.

*Before you dive in know what you're getting yourself into—financially.
